NHT SubOne Controller cable replacement sources
Hi,
I have an NHT SubOne (Sub One) subwoofer and recently I accidentally damaged the cable that connects the controller to the main unit. I contacted NHT to obtain a new cable, and they told me there would be a long wait for a replacement, and they were also not very forthcoming about what the configuration of the cable is and whether it can be obtained from any other source. For anyone else who is in the same boat, this is what I found: It is an 8 pin mini din male to male straight through cable. Cables designed for the Mac will *not* work, because those are not straight through (which means pin 1 in connected to pin 1 out, etc.) I was able to get a 6' cable from STSI (Stevenson Technical Services, Inc.); here is the web page for that item: http://www.stsi.com/Merchant2/mercha...t_ Code=22167 I also got a 25' cable from I.E.C. in Commerce City, CO. If you go to their web page, http://www.iec.net/, and do a search on the text: 8 pin mini din male to male straight through the relevant items will come up (you want the male to male). Both of these work fine with my sub; try at your own risk. Regards to all, Mark p.s. I do not check mail at the above address. |
